Gokul Agro Resources Appoints Rajesh C. Tarpara, Dr. Pritha Dev & Manharbhai K. Jadav As Independent Directors
Gokul Agro Resources Limited has appointed Rajesh Chhaganbhai Tarpara, Dr. Pritha Dev, and Manharbhai Kurjibhai Jadav as Non-Executive Independent Directors for a five-year term following approval from shareholders through a postal ballot. Tarpara and Dr. Dev joined the Board on May 15, 2026, while Jadav’s appointment came into effect on June 8, 2026.
Rajesh Tarpara is an Independent Director with over 25 years of professional experience in corporate and legal advisory services. His areas of expertise include secretarial practices, Corporate Governance, legal matters, mergers and amalgamations, finance, direct and indirect taxation, GST, and regulatory compliance. He provides advisory services in Company Law compliance, IPO consultancy, taxation matters, liaising, litigation, and scrutiny-related areas. Through his professional practice, he has worked across various business disciplines, supporting organisations in regulatory and corporate governance requirements. He holds a bachelor’s degree in commerce and an LL.B. degree and has been a practicing Company Secretary since 2003.
Dr. Pritha Dev is an Independent Director with academic experience in economics and research. She is an Associate Professor in the Economics area at the Indian Institute of Management Ahmedabad, where she has been associated since 2015. Before joining IIM Ahmedabad, she served as faculty at the Business School of Instituto Tecnológico Autónomo de México (ITAM) in Mexico City. Her areas of expertise include economics, quantitative research, and academic studies. Dr. Dev earned her bachelor’s degree in economics from the University of Rajasthan. She holds a Ph.D. in economics from New York University, completed in 2008, and a master’s degree in quantitative economics from the Indian Statistical Institute, Delhi.
Manharbhai Kurjibhai Jadav is former Secretary of the Water Resources Department, Government of Gujarat. He has been serving as an Independent Director with over 44 years of experience in infrastructure development, water resource management, and public administration. He has held leadership roles in government service and corporate sectors, with expertise in policy formulation, project execution and contract management. He currently serves as Vice President at LCC Projects Ltd., where he contributes his experience in infrastructure and governance. His professional background combines technical knowledge with administrative expertise, supporting board-level oversight and strategic decision-making. He holds a bachelor’s degree in civil engineering from Gujarat University.
